DrySail
DrySail describes boats that are stored on land with launch and retrieval from the water every time you go sailing.
Representative Classes include:
- Catamarans: Nacra, Hobie (various sizes)
- Trimarans: Weta
- Dinghies: Laser, Byte, 420, 470, 505, 29er 49er, Lightning, Albacore, Wayfarer and others….
- Drykeel: Shark Soling, Melges 24, Dragon, J22 and others….
Facilities include:
- DrySail Clubhouse with change rooms, washrooms, and hot showers
- Sail and Spar Storage
- Launch areas – large sand beach and concrete ramp for dolly launch of Dinghies and Cats
- Dinghy dollies, catamaran dollies, trailer dollies.
- Drykeel uses crane/jib with a two ton electric hoist
- Heavy wheeled launch public ramp nearby
We are a self-help club, which goes the distance in keeping the costs of membership down. Every member contributes hours towards the running of the Club and the events we host. It’s a great way to meet other members, gets everybody involved in creating a great sailing Club, and is one of the reasons for our success.

Membership
EYC has progressive membership options for all ages: Junior Membership for all ages under 22, Intermediate Membership for ages 22 to 35, and Senior DrySail Membership. Each option permits a member to keep a DrySail boat on site (subject to space availability) and have use of all the club’s facilities. Please refer to the Membership section for details.
